org.apache.manifoldcf.crawler.connectors.webcrawler
Class FormItem

java.lang.Object
  extended by org.apache.manifoldcf.crawler.connectors.webcrawler.FormItem
All Implemented Interfaces:
FormDataElement

public class FormItem
extends java.lang.Object
implements FormDataElement

This class provides an individual data item


Field Summary
protected  boolean isEnabled
           
protected  java.lang.String name
           
protected  int type
           
protected  java.lang.String value
           
 
Fields inherited from interface org.apache.manifoldcf.crawler.connectors.webcrawler.FormDataElement
_rcsid
 
Constructor Summary
FormItem(java.lang.String name, java.lang.String value, int type, boolean isEnabled)
           
 
Method Summary
 java.lang.String getElementName()
          Get the element name
 java.lang.String getElementValue()
          Get the element value
 boolean getEnabled()
           
 int getType()
           
 void setEnabled(boolean enabled)
           
 void setValue(java.lang.String value)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

name

protected java.lang.String name

value

protected java.lang.String value

isEnabled

protected boolean isEnabled

type

protected int type
Constructor Detail

FormItem

public FormItem(java.lang.String name,
                java.lang.String value,
                int type,
                boolean isEnabled)
Method Detail

setEnabled

public void setEnabled(boolean enabled)

getEnabled

public boolean getEnabled()

setValue

public void setValue(java.lang.String value)

getType

public int getType()

getElementName

public java.lang.String getElementName()
Get the element name

Specified by:
getElementName in interface FormDataElement

getElementValue

public java.lang.String getElementValue()
Get the element value

Specified by:
getElementValue in interface FormDataElement